Lawyers On Demand Limited is seeking a Securitisation Senior Legal Counsel to join a British Financial Institution for at least 6 months. You will manage securitisation transactions, structuring and drafting complex legal documents.
The role requires mid to senior-level experience in a similar environment with transactional expertise, especially in forward flow arrangements. Flexibility in working on-site and remotely is offered.
This is an exciting opportunity with market leading clients such as Google and Barclays.
